John Williams was selected as the deputy administrator for management in the Farm Service Agency. He succeeded George Aldaya, who held that position, first as the acting deputy administrator for management and then as the deputy administrator for management, from September 1995 until March 1999, when he became the deputy director of the Office of Operations. From July 1998 until his selection, Williams served as FSAs assistant deputy administrator for management. He was director of the agencys Management Services Division from 1995-98. Williams served as the deputy assistant administrator for management in the Foreign Agricultural Service from 1988-95. From 1983-88 he was director of FASs Budget and Finance Division, after having served as chief of the Budget Branch in that Division from 1976-83. From 1970-76 he worked as a budget analyst for the agency. He began his career with FAS as a management intern in 1969. A native of Dallas, Pa., Williams holds a B.A. degree in political science from Kings College in Wilkes-Barre, Pa. |
